A BILL TO BE ENTITLED 1
AN ACT TO ALLOW SECU RITY GUARDS TO CARRY FIREARMS ON NONPUBL IC 2
EDUCATIONAL PROPERTY. 3
The General Assembly of North Carolina enacts: 4
SECTION 1. G.S. 14-269.2(g) is amended by adding a new subdivision to read: 5
"(8) A sworn law enforcement officer who is hired as an armed security guard by 6
a nonpublic school operating under Part I or II of Article 39 of Chapter 115C 7
of the General Statutes, provided that the officer is acting in the discharge of 8
the officer's official duties on the premises of that school. For purposes of this 9
subdivision, a sworn law enforcement officer shall include a sworn law 10
enforcement officer certified under Chapter 17C or 17E of the General 11
Statutes, a company police officer commissioned under Chapter 74E of the 12
General Statutes, or a campus police officer commissioned under Chapter 74G 13
of the General Statutes." 14
SECTION 2. This act becomes effective December 1, 2025, and applies to offenses 15
committed on or after that date. 16
